jQuery購物車求和功能的實現
在網站開發中,購物車的功能無疑是非常重要的,然而其中的求和功能又是必不可少的。利用jQuery的強大功能,我們可以輕松實現購物車中的商品數量求和。
// 獲取所有商品數量的元素 var numInputs = $(".num-input"); // 監聽所有商品數量變化時的事件 numInputs.on("change", function() { var total = 0; // 遍歷所有商品數量元素,累加數量 numInputs.each(function(i, el) { var val = parseFloat($(el).val()); if (!isNaN(val)) { total += val; } }); // 更新合計數量 $("#total-number").text(total); });
上述代碼通過獲取所有商品數量的元素,監聽變化事件,并遍歷累加數量,最終更新合計數量。注意,這里使用了parseFloat函數,將字符串轉換成浮點數,同時也進行了判斷,避免了非法輸入的情況。
總之,利用jQuery提供的功能,我們可以很方便地實現購物車中商品數量的求和,為網站用戶帶來更好的購物體驗。
下一篇css怎么把延遲弄低